What happens when you put purple on orange?

Mixing purple and orange together creates various hues of brown depending on the amount of orange and purple used. Adding more orange brightens the shade of brown due to the red and yellow primary colors. Adding additional purple darkens the shade of brown due to the red and blue primary colors.

What color is blue and purple mixed?

Mixing blue and purple requires you to mix a primary color with a secondary color. Mixing these colors together creates the tertiary color blue-violet.

Does purple and green make blue?

No. It makes brown. Blue is a primary colour and you can’t get it by blending other paints. Blue plus red makes purple; blue plus yellow makes green.
